I just so happened to be in the hallway today when the bell rang between periods. As they had done throughout the day, senior girls led the way dressed in borrowed jerseys and jogging in formation. With military-style cadence they sang out, We are the seniors, the mighty, mighty seniors. Caught in between my classroom and the copier room, I stepped aside and watched as students laughed and sang along to music that blared from loudspeakers. I studied the smiling faces of boys and girls eager for the end-of-day assembly and the Homecoming weekend that follows. I felt a sudden, unexpected pang of sorrow. Youth is so fleeting. All those carefree, fresh-faced kids will soon enough be rushing to college classes, punching a time clock or defending our country in some foreign land. They will know great joy, but they will never escape the sorrow that comes with living. Youth is ephemeral. That is its beauty. It is a perfect summers day remembered in the bitter cold of winter.
